HR's Role in Shaping the Future of Well-Being and Fostering Resiliency

As organizations work through unprecedented change, HR is leading the charge to meet the evolving needs of the workforce. Building resiliency, restoring and redefining work/life balance, and managing health and safety concerns are top priorities. How do people strategies need to adapt to promote holistic well-being, strengthen employees’ connection to your mission and purpose, and build a resilient workforce that can thrive in a rapidly changing economy?

Join this session as HR leaders discuss:

  • Strategies to promote resiliency, avoid burnout, and provide equitable support for all employees
  • Fostering connection, balance, and productivity for remote, hybrid and on-site employees
  • Paving a new path for work/life integration after a year of intense and unsustainable overlap between family and career demands
